Aspen Non-Racer Schedule

2019 Preliminary
Non-Racer Event Schedule  

You must wear your DISC credential at all DISC events, both on and off the hill. All PARTICIPANTS must wear helmets.

Download the racer schedule as a pdf »


WEDS, March 6

9 am & Noon (Optional for early arrivals) Meet at base of the Silver Queen Gondola to ski with DISC friends and Pros on Aspen Mountain.

3:00 - 6:00 pm 
Registration at Limelight Hotel - Monarch Room, get your credentials, sign your waivers, pick up your gift bags along with drinks & snacks. https://www.limelighthotels.com/aspen

6:00 - 10:00 pm   
Welcome Reception at 7908, https://7908aspen.com (reception style dinner & wine tasting, dressy casual attire) Sponsored by SVB & Diligent

THURS, March 7

9:00 am Meet your local Guides & Ambassadors at the base of the Gondola for a guided tour of Aspen Mountain, including optional beginner racing experience on the Nastar race course from 9 - 11 am.

11:45 am-1:00 pm Lunch at Bonnie’s Restaurant (at the base of the race course).

1:00-4:00 pm Free Skiing with DISC Guides/Ambassadors.

6:00 - 10:00 pm   
Celebrating 50 Years of DISC History and Benefit Dinner for U.S. Ski & Snowboard and Aspen Valley Ski Club. Silent & Live Auction. Non-racers guests will be assigned to a team here to dine with each evening and root for on the hill. (Seated dinner, cocktail attire). Featuring Caprice Wines http://hoteljerome.aubergeresorts.com

FRI, March 8

9:00 am & 10:00 am Meet your Mountain Guides & Ambassadors at the base of the Gondola for a guided tour of Aspen Mountain, including optional beginner racing experience on the Nastar race course from 9 - 11 am. You will receive tips on the Nastar race course and tour the hidden shrines all over the mountain including Elvis, Jerry Garcia and more!

11:45 am-1:00 pm Lunch at Bonnie’s Restaurant, at the base of the race course.

1:00-3:00 pm Skiing and cheering on the Afternoon Races on North American Run.

6:30 - 10:30 pm
Wild, Wild, West Tequila Party at T Lazy 7 Lodge (reception style BBQ dinner, bring on your best boot stomping cowboy attire - Cowboy hats, jeans, boots encouraged!) - Featuring Casamigas Tequila. Transportation provided from the Limelight and Hotel Jerome starting at 6 pm. http://www.tlazy7.com

SAT, March 9

9:00 am & 10:00 am Meet your Mountain Guides & Ambassadors at the base of the Gondola for skiing and optional beginner racing experience on the Nastar race course from 9 - 11 am. They will have some fun race cheering paraphernalia for everyone to help cheer on the races on North American Run.

11:45 am-1:00 pm Lunch at Bonnie’s Restaurant, at the base of the race course

1:00-3:00 pm Afternoon Races on North American Run. Cheer on your team!

3:30 - 6:00 pm               
Pink Après Ski Rosé Pool & Hot Tub Party at Limelight Hotel, (Wear something pink! - bathrobes/swimsuits or apres ski attire) - Sponsored by Triennes Rosé  https://www.limelighthotels.com/aspen

7:00 - 11:00 pm       
Closing Awards Dinner at Sundeck Restaurant on Aspen Mountain (Seated dinner, Bond theme - “For Your Eyes Only” - 80’s Bond evening attire). Featuring Sodhani Vineyards https://www.thelittlenell.com/occasions/weddings/venues/sundeck
